Cleaning up a drain is not enjoyable by any means, but it is an important part of being a property owner or renter. When you clean your restroom drains every month, you can prevent obstructions, prevent bad odors, and identify underlying problems that could lead to expensive repair costs. Cleaning up a drain is easy, and just takes ten minutes with a snake and drain cleaner. While there is nothing wrong with cleaning your bathroom drains yourself, we advise that you have a plumbing professional tidy all of the drains pipes in your house every couple of months. Here is an extensive take a look at why you ought to clean your restroom drains monthly:
1. Avoid Blockages
One of the most obvious reasons for cleaning your restroom drains every month is to avoid obstructions. When you tidy your drains pipes regularly, you will not end up with deep clogs that require strong chemicals and expert devices. While you can clean your bathroom drains pipes on your own, we advise that you call a plumbing to expertly clean your drains a couple of times per year.
2. Avoid Bad Odors
A professional plumber can not just unblock your drain however likewise ventilate it. You can put hot water and bleach down the drain to get rid of some of the bad smells, but that is just a momentary repair.
3. Recognize Underlying Issues
When you clean your drain once a month, you can recognize underlying issues prior to they end up being major problems. For example, if you see debris coming out of your bathroom drains with a snake cleaner, they could be wearing away. Any irregular products coming out of a drain must raise issues. If it is not just the typical hair and gunk, you must call a plumbing technician to see if your restroom drains pipes requirement to be fixed.
4. Faster Draining
A slow-draining sink or shower is a excellent indication that you need to clean up the pipelines. When you clean your drains monthly, you ought to never ever have to worry about slow-draining sinks or showers.
5. Prevent Substantial Damage
As discussed, regularly cleaning your restroom drains can assist determine underlying issues that are more serious than a sink obstructed with hair. The average cost to repair a drain line is $696, which is much more pricey than the mere $10 it takes to clean your drains regular monthly. Serious obstructions can damage your entire plumbing system and even have an effect on the general public systems and the quality of water.

If you have a gas hot water heater, you should routinely examine the pilot light for excessive soot accumulation. Extreme soot accumulation can trigger a blocked flue, which can result in carbon monoxide gas dripping into your house. Thus, a regular check up of the pilot light is really essential in making sure there isn't a buildup of soot.
Get rid of odors in your waste-disposal system. Oftentimes' odors in your waste-disposal unit may not suggest a clog, but just little food particles that have started to rot. Place a mix of lemon peel and ice in the system, and run it for about a minute. Follow this with a good quantity of cold water. If this does not help, attempt a degrease or specialized garbage disposal cleaner.
Ensure that you avoid throwing fats down the drain after you clean up your meal. Fats can strengthen with time which can trigger a drainage issue and corrupt your water circulation. Throw out fats and various types of cooking oils in the garbage after you finish with your meal.
To eliminate dirt that accumulates under the edges of faucets, think about using an old tooth brush, rather than cleansing items. Numerous cleaning products will simply cause damage to your faucets, and some of this damage could be severe. Simply dip the tooth brush into warm water and after that utilize it.

Waste disposal unit are a typical reason for pipes issues, which is an simple issue to resolve. Do not simply put whatever down the disposal or treat it like a second trash can. Utilize the disposal things that would be tough to get rid of usually. Putting all remaining food down the sink is a great way to produce clogs.
Ensure to never ever leave any flammable liquids near your hot water heater. Certain liquids like fuel, solvents, or adhesives are combustible, and if left too near to the water heater, can ignite. If you have to have these liquids in your basement, place it far away from your water heater.
